What is the primary requirement for a teacher's self-assessment according to the Texas teacher appraisal process?

Explanation:
The primary requirement for a teacher's self-assessment according to the Texas teacher appraisal process is that it must be completed in a timely manner to allow for thorough review. Completing the self-assessment so that it can be reviewed by the appraiser at least two weeks before the summative conference ensures that both the teacher and the appraiser have sufficient time to reflect on the results and discuss them in depth during the conference. This process fosters a meaningful dialogue about the teacher’s performance, strengths, and areas for improvement, which is essential for professional development and growth. The requirement emphasizes the importance of preparation and planning in the appraisal process, ensuring that the self-assessment is not only a reflective tool but also a critical part of the evaluation meeting. It allows the appraiser to provide more informed feedback based on the self-assessment, and supports the teacher's continuous improvement in instructional practice.
